My name is Melanie Wheeler I have been eeling for years to catch trotline bait. I have never seen an eel sooo beautiful. I caught this one of a kind eel on the patuxent river near Solomons Bridge. I use razor clams for eel bait. I am keeping the eel alive in my fish pond.
DNR's Reponse
Thank you Melanie for sending in the eel with the color variation, our eel expert was impressed to say the least. We have never seen this variation before though the life stage for this size eel is commonly called "yellow eel", may be this is why.
